Aside from shiny sequined jackets (not my normal wardrobe, I promise) and Ben’s enthusiastic “business guy” cameo, we presented a prototype of the next version of Docker Datacenter, our commercial solution for running containers-as-a-service (CaaS) in an on-premises or public cloud enterprise environment. Docker Datacenter is an integrated CaaS platform to securely ship, orchestrate and manage Dockerized apps and system resources. The sneak peek during the keynote shows a prototype UI and features. Some of the things you saw may change as we get to launch but what’s important are the capabilities we are bringing to the enterprise platform.
